I know Dave usually bars and A chord with his first finger. But does he play, or do you guys play it like? 0222x ...... or 02222 ????

well, 02222 isn't an A chord. it's an A6.

I play it with my index finger. makes transitions so much easier.

i use my index finger to do the x02220 a chord too cause you're right, the transitions are much easier. but i think my fingers are too big cause when i do that, or when i barre the same chord (x23332 x34443 etc) i can never get the high e string to play. i'm always muting it by accident. oh well, only sucks when i'm doing arppegios or something.

well while we're talking about chords, how many of you play the open D string in songs like Billies, Grey Street, you know what chords I am talking about. I play it open and think it sounds fine, and I think that Dave plays it open too.

like:

--------
--------
2---4----2---4-----7----6
0---0----0---0-----0----0
x---x----x---x-----x----x
2---3----2---3-----7----5

thats the billies intro, i recoment using all ur fingers and it flows so smooth watch the vid if u need too
grey st:

--
--
7---4----6----2
0---0----0----0
x---x----x----x
7---3----5----2

play around its easy to hear it and go, see the pattern?
